Amazon selling at-home COVID-19 testing kits
January 7, 2021
Shoppers on Amazon.com can order a home testing kit to detect the presence of COVID-19 in their systems. The kit, which sells for $110 for one and $1,000 for a 10-pack, requires individuals to spit into a tube and return it to a testing lab.
